Output 10707930bf6307067c8d4569af68cd75e867c5ded15035855b223d303218250c:54

value
861189
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f0460737d3e75c5d85e44ef97d3074afc2dc9b67 OP_EQUAL
address
3PbTzE9BSedr8zkViMXDQbWbJEBhpLbScX
transaction
10707930bf6307067c8d4569af68cd75e867c5ded15035855b223d303218250c
spent
true